Eskom has announced the suspension of load shedding until next week Friday at 4 o’clock. The power utility attributes this decision to a consistent improvement in available generating capacity.

The Electricity Minister, Kgosientsho Ramokgopa, recently disclosed that Eskom’s generation capacity has reached 55%, with plans to elevate it to 60% in the first quarter of the coming year.

The suspension provides a welcomed respite for South African residents and businesses, as Eskom pledges to remain vigilant, closely monitoring the power system for any developments and promptly communicating significant changes.
